Output 9c56fc6e67606ff93bbba294e97f68dc33daa67532ae99b51c74f2661a5997f5:19

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3f0daf443cc4acee9522db639c1b2e3952a9ba OP_EQUAL
address
A6miHYA93RwAozEGEKX2EewW9NCx2PpGHa
transaction
9c56fc6e67606ff93bbba294e97f68dc33daa67532ae99b51c74f2661a5997f5